US Automotive Electric Power Steering Market Overview:
As per MRFR analysis, the US Automotive Electric Power Steering Market Size was estimated at 3.92 (USD Billion) in 2023. The US Automotive Electric Power Steering Market Industry is expected to grow from 4.5(USD Billion) in 2024 to 7 (USD Billion) by 2035. The US Automotive Electric Power Steering Market CAGR (growth rate) is expected to be around 4.098% during the forecast period (2025 - 2035).

US Automotive Electric Power Steering Market Drivers
Growing Adoption of Electric Vehicles in the US
The increasing demand for electric vehicles (EVs) in the US significantly drives the US Automotive Electric Power Steering Market Industry. According to the US Department of Energy, sales of electric vehicles have increased by over 40% in the previous year alone, reflecting a growing acceptance of EV technology among consumers. Major automotive manufacturers like Tesla and Ford are investing heavily in EV development, with projections showing that by 2030, EVs could account for nearly 30% of all vehicle sales in the US.
This shift towards EVs necessitates advanced steering technologies, leading to a robust demand for electric power steering systems. The incorporation of electric power steering helps enhance the energy efficiency of electric vehicles, thus aligning with the automotive industry's transition towards sustainability. As legislative support and consumer preference push towards more environmentally friendly vehicles, the prospects for the US Automotive Electric Power Steering Market are looking very positive.

Stringent Government Regulations and Safety Standards
Government regulations aiming at enhancing vehicle safety are key drivers for the US Automotive Electric Power Steering Market Industry. The US government has mandated stringent fuel economy standards, which pressure manufacturers to adopt more energy-efficient technologies such as electric power steering.
The Corporate Average Fuel Economy standards require automakers to achieve a fleet-wide average of 54.5 miles per gallon by 2025, compelling manufacturers to transition towards systems that optimize energy consumption.Entities like the Environmental Protection Agency play a crucial role in establishing these regulations, supporting a swift shift towards advanced technologies like electric power steering. In response, automotive manufacturers are increasingly integrating electric power steering into their designs to comply with these regulations, thereby bolstering market growth.

Automotive Electric Power Steering Market Type Insights
The US Automotive Electric Power Steering Market is experiencing significant growth with a notable focus on various types classified primarily into Column Electric Power Steering, Rack Electric Power Steering, and Pinion Electric Power Steering. Column Electric Power Steering systems, typically integrated into smaller vehicles, have become prominent due to their compact design and ease of installation. These systems are favored in urban environments where space is limited and the need for agile handling is critical. They use electric motors positioned at the steering column, which enables a direct connection to the steering wheel, enhancing responsiveness and reducing the physical effort required by the driver. On the other hand, Rack Electric Power Steering is increasingly being adopted in a wide array of vehicle models due to its efficiency and performance advantages.
This type of system connects the electric motor directly to the rack, allowing for improved steering feel and feedback. With advancements in technology, Rack Electric Power Steering also supports features such as variable assist steering, which adapts the level of steering assistance based on vehicle speed. This is particularly valuable for improving fuel efficiency and enhancing overall driving comfort, making it a preferred choice among manufacturers aiming to cater to safety and sustainability trends in the automotive industry.
Pinion Electric Power Steering is another notable type that contributes to the overall dynamics of the US Automotive Electric Power Steering Market. This system utilizes a pinion gear that engages directly with the steering rack. Its design is lauded for providing a more direct and responsive steering experience, which is crucial for high-performance vehicles that demand superior handling characteristics. The simplicity of the Pinion system also translates into reduced maintenance and production costs, making it an attractive option for many vehicle manufacturers in today’s competitive market.

Automotive Electric Power Steering Market Technology Insights
The Technology segment of the US Automotive Electric Power Steering Market encompasses various innovative solutions that enhance vehicle performance, comfort, and efficiency. Brushless DC Motors stand out as a key component, owing to their high efficiency and reliability, which contribute significantly to reduced energy consumption and improved vehicle responsiveness. Similarly, Stepper Motors are gaining traction due to their precision control, enabling smoother steering adjustments that enhance driver experience. The Integrated Electric Power Steering system is essential as it combines multiple functionalities into a compact unit, minimizing space while maximizing the effect of steering assist and enhancing overall vehicle dynamics.
These technologies not only support the growing demand for fuel-efficient and environmentally friendly vehicles but also address safety concerns by improving steering feedback and control.
